talking about prisons, kahve pera.
  • a middle-aged man with a mustache and a half-open western shirt, holding a cup of coffee: you are british?
  • me: i'm american.
  • him: american? where in america?
  • me: los angeles.
  • him: puh. los angeles. makes american movies.
  • me: you don't like american movies?
  • him: i hate Midnight Express.
  • me: what's wrong with Midnight Express?
  • him: it misrepresents turkish prison.
  • me: yeah, i'm sure turkish prisons aren't that bad.
  • him: no, turkish prisons are that bad. misrepresents because the man escapes from the prison. you cannot escape from turkish prisons.
  • me: really? so the prisons are that horrible?
  • him: yes. better that way. punishes criminals.
  • me: but what if you get thrown in jail?
  • him: i don't get thrown in jail. i don't do anything illegal.
  • me: what if you get thrown in jail by accident?
  • him: you do not get thrown in jail by accident here. this is not america.
  • me: how so?
  • him: here there is a list, things you cannot do. you do them, you go to jail. i have been to new york once. there, you have a list of things you are allowed to do. you do something not on the list, you go to jail.
